Blazer Brass 158 Grain Jacketed Hollow-Point (JHP) Ammo Details

A personal protection load that’s priced low enough not to prohibit you from training with it is a valuable thing indeed. Only with one of those can you really master the ins and outs of the round to which you may one day owe your life. With a case of 357 Magnums like these by Blazer Brass, your wallet won’t keep you from becoming totally proficient at self-defense.

This round has a 158 grain jacketed hollow point projectile. Such a bullet easily penetrates the sorts of barriers that may have shielded a threat, and expands dramatically during penetration that you can neutralize it with only one well-placed hit. While Blazer’s best known for their sharp-looking aluminum cased ammo, this one’s brass casing affords its owner the opportunity to handload after the fact. Blazer’s Boxer is non-corrosive to keep your revolver’s bore happier, and their propellant burns without producing a great deal of foul residue as well.
